NTT America, Inc.
25 mile radius of Mexico City
9/26/2025
Guadalajara, MX, MX
Guadalajara, MX, MX
Guadalajara, MX, MX
Mexico City, MX
Guadalajara, MX, MX
Mexico City, MX
Guadalajara, MX
Gdl, MX, MX
Mexico City, MX
Queretaro, MX